The Registration Journey at 777 Casino, Step-by-Step
Getting started with 777 Casino from New Zealand is a breeze but requires attention to detail if you want to avoid any stall-outs later. Here’s the sign-up flow the site follows:
- Head to the official 777.com website and click the “Join Now” or “Sign Up” button, usually perched at the top-right corner.
- Fill in personal details like your full name (make sure it matches your official ID), date of birth, and country of residence.
- Set your username and a strong password, then create a security question for account recovery — an old-school but effective extra step.
- Enter your accurate residential address and phone number. This isn’t just paperwork; 777 uses these to verify your identity later and prevent fraud.
- Tick the boxes confirming you’re over 18, accept the terms and conditions, and optionally subscribe to marketing emails.
- Submit the form, then check your email for a verification link. Clicking it activates your account.
The process demands precision. Fake or mismatched info can lock you out when you want to withdraw winnings. 777’s interface keeps the flow smooth and clear, avoiding a maze of confusing forms.

Why Geo-Blocking Exists and How It Affects Kiwi Players at 777 Casino
Even if you’re keen on 777’s retro Vegas vibe, geo-restrictions are about legal compliance more than keeping you out for fun. Offshore casinos like 777 must respect restrictions placed by licensing authorities, which often means blocking IP addresses from countries they’re not authorised to operate in. So, if you try signing up from New Zealand but the casino hasn’t greenlit Kiwi players or hasn’t got permissions for your location, you’ll likely get blocked before you even hit “Register.”
Try pushing past this by entering fake location info or using sketchy proxies, and you’re walking on thin ice. 777’s tech watches for mismatches between your IP and your details, so this usually ends with a dead-end account or worse—closure without warning.

How to Claim and Activate Bonuses Without Tripping Up
Once you’re signed up, the next step is unlocking those sweet bonus treats. The trick is moving through the activation steps without falling into the trap of missing key terms. A common snag is rushing deposits without selecting the bonus or ticking opt-in boxes where needed. Sometimes you’ll be asked to enter a bonus code—keep an eye out for that or the promos might just pass you by.
Be on the lookout for terms like:
- Wagering requirements: How often you need to play through bonus funds before withdrawing.
- Game restrictions: Some bonus spins only work on select pokies, so try not to waste them on a non-qualifier game.
- Expiry dates: Bonuses usually don’t last forever. Use them before they vanish.
Following the bonus directions precisely means those spins and cashback deals actually turn into real cash in your wallet.
